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Langwathby to Ashfield start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Langwathby to Ashfield start from £52.80 one way, or £75.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Langwathby to Ashfield are available for £54.90 one way, or £109.80 return

Everything you need to know about Langwathby Station

Welcome to Langwathby Train Station

Langwathby train station is nestled in the tranquil Eden Valley of Cumbria, providing a perfect fusion of natural beauty and quaint rural charm. This lovely countryside station forms part of the Settle-Carlisle Line, renowned for its picturesque landscapes and historical railway architecture. Whether you're a local resident, a tourist, or a train enthusiast, Langwathby offers a delightful travel experience just waiting to be explored.

Facilities and Services

As small and serene as Langwathby Station is, it does not possess ticket buying facilities on site, such as a ticket office or machines for ticket collection. So, be sure to purchase your tickets in advance online or via mobile and either opt for electronic tickets or choose a larger, staffed station nearby for in-person collection.

The station is unstaffed, though it offers a functional help point for customers. Furthermore, the station provides step-free access, and boarding ramps are available on all trains making it largely accessible for those with mobility needs.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Ashfield station, though modest in its provisions, delivers essential facilities aimed at ensuring a seamless travel experience. While there are no ticket office facilities or machines, smartcard validators are available for passengers with an induction loop for those requiring hearing assistance.

Accessibility is a cornerstone of Ashfield Station. It's classified as a Category A station, meaning it offers step-free access throughout. This includes both platforms, which are equipped with help points, enabling passengers to request assistance when needed. CCTV surveillance provides an added layer of security for travelers. Despite the absence of facilities like toilets, waiting rooms with available seating ensure a degree of comfort as passengers anticipate their trains.

Connectivity and Travel Links

Travelling to and from Ashfield Station connects you to a network of local travel options, supporting onward journeys with ease. Rail replacement services are conveniently arranged along the main Ashfield Road at the station's front, perfectly placed for quick access.

While taxis and buses are accessible through online resources, like www.traintaxi.co.uk and www.travelinescotland.com, the station does not currently offer cycle hire, although bicycle storage is available for six bikes. This makes Ashfield a well-positioned juncture for multimodal travel.
